ASA UWF1000 f1.3 Ultra Wide Field telescope system
Astrosysteme Austria
 
ASA UWF1000 f1.3 high end telescope

ideal platform for wide field imaging!

The UWF1000 f1.3 telescope is the ideal platform for wide field imaging and all-sky surveys. The UWF1000 f1.3 features a highly aspheric 5-lens corrector and motorized focusing with absolute encoders. The main mirror and the corrector can be collimated fully electronic to allow an easy and fast remote collimation.
The UWF1000 ensures precise focus and high-resolution data acquisition of the night sky – in the shortest possible time!

Main Facts

Optical design
Ultra Wide Field, prime corrector
Linear central obstruction
48%
Focal length
1300mm
Focal ratio system
f1.3
Clear Aperture / Focal Ratio Primary Mirror
1000mm (39.3 inch) / f1.3
Image field
84mm (3.70 degrees)
Mirror material
Fused silica (option Zerodur)
Image Quality FWHM
<4um RMS
Surface quality
>80 strehl
Microroughness
1.3nm RMS / <0.7nm Ra
Coating
Al+SiO2 >96%
Back Focus from flange
81mm
Total weight
1900kg (4189lbs) (no camera or filter)
Motor
ASA Direct Drive
Latitude Range
20 to 80 degrees views
Software
ASA Software package with a platform-independent Ascom Alpaca API (via TCP/IP), compatibility with numerous programs, and many additional API features for:
• Creating and optimizing pointing files
• MLPT (e.g., usable with a N.I.N.A plugin)
• Uploading and tracking TLE and CPF satellite orbits
• Orbit corrections when satellite tracking (autoguiding with external CCD cameras)
• Focus control also via Ascom Alpaca API
• Covers (if installed) via Ascom Alpaca API

Max. slew speeds
Up to 50 degrees per second
Pointing Accuracy (20° to 85°)
<8” RMS with pointing model and ASA telescope
Tracking Accuracy (20° to 85° – unguided, with current pointingfile)
<0,25” RMS within 5 minutes
System Natural Frequency
10 Hz or greater
